safeguarding policy

A safeguarding policy is a crucial document that outlines the responsibilities, procedures, and guidelines for individuals working with children. Its main purpose is to ensure the welfare and protection of children from any form of harm or abuse. This policy sets clear expectations for staff and volunteers regarding appropriate behavior and the identification of potential risks. It also provides a framework for reporting any concerns or incidents involving children, as well as the necessary steps to be taken to address them. By implementing a robust safeguarding policy, organisations can create a safe and nurturing environment where children can thrive and reach their full potential. It is essential for all staff members to familiarise themselves with this policy and actively promote the well-being of children under their care.
